<a name="models.metaclass.copy_and_replace_m2m_through_model"></a>
|
||||||
|
#### copy\_and\_replace\_m2m\_through\_model
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
```python
|
||||||
|
copy_and_replace_m2m_through_model(field: Type[ManyToManyField], field_name: str, table_name: str, parent_fields: Dict, attrs: Dict, meta: ModelMeta) -> None
|
||||||
|
```
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
Clones class with Through model for m2m relations, appends child name to the name
|
||||||
|
of the cloned class.
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
Clones non foreign keys fields from parent model, the same with database columns.
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
Modifies related_name with appending child table name after '_'
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
For table name, the table name of child is appended after '_'.
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
Removes the original sqlalchemy table from metadata if it was not removed.
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
**Arguments**:
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
- `field (Type[ManyToManyField])`: field with relations definition
|
||||||
|
- `field_name (str)`: name of the relation field
|
||||||
|
- `table_name (str)`: name of the table
|
||||||
|
- `parent_fields (Dict)`: dictionary of fields to copy to new models from parent
|
||||||
|
- `attrs (Dict)`: new namespace for class being constructed
|
||||||
|
- `meta (ModelMeta)`: metaclass of currently created model
|
